Design is redefined and the role of the designer is
expanding beyond aesthetics:
• More strategic
• More business-oriented
• Larger scope of problems to solve
• Bigger roles in organizations

The Design Thinker:
• Empathic
• Integrative thinking
• Optimism
• Experimentalism (Experientialism?)
• Collaborative
- 20. © Touch360. All Rights Reserved.
Principles:
• Prototyping
• Iterative process
• User-centric
• Team effort
• Experience design (emotional aspects)
• Systems thinking (holistic)
• More weight to qualitative/observational research
• Embraces chaos
• Process moves through Inspiration, Ideation and
Implementation
